Warning Signs You Need Insulation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Keep an eye out for these common indicators of insulation water damage: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ice persistent musty smells in your home, it may show water damage in your insulation. Don’t ignore these odors, as they can be a sign of mold growth and health risks.
Visible Water Stains or Leaks
Water stains or leaks on your ceiling, walls, or floors can be a sign of insulation water damage. If left untreated, these issues can lead to structural damage and costly repairs.
Mold Growth or Black Spots
Mold growth or black spots on your walls, ceiling, or insulation can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ore these issues, as they can spread quickly and cause health risks.
Increased Energy Bills
If your energy bills are increasing, it may show insulation water damage. Water-damaged insulation can reduce your home’s energy efficiency, leading to higher bills.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ks in your walls or ceiling can be a sign of insulation water damage. Don’t ignore these issues, as they can be a sign of structural damage.
Visible Puddles or Water Accumulation
Visible puddles or water accumulation on your floor or in your walls can be a sign of insulation water damage. Don’t ignore these issues, as they can lead to structural damage and costly repairs.

Insulation Water Damage Restoration Cost in Smithfield, NC
The cost of Insulation Water Damage Restoration varies based on the severity of the issue,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Smithfield, NC.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the scope of the project. We’ll provide a detailed estimate after conducting an on-site assessment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Inspection and Assessment | $100 – $500 | Severity of the issue and size of the affected area |
| Water Removal and Drying | $500 – $2,000 | Amount of water and type of equipment needed |
| Insulation Repair and Repl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area and type of insulation used |
| Mold Remediation and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of the mold growth and type of sanitizing agents used |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$100 – $500 | Size of the affected area and type of cleaning required |
